[master] Fix the way categories are handled in text mode.
by Samantha N. Bueno
This statically maintained list of spoke categories for text mode has
been bothering me for almost a year, so it's time to get rid of it.
This now more or less mirrors the GUI logic we have for handling spoke
categories. I wanted to originally make the category classes something
that could be used by both GUI and TUI to reduce duplication, but it is
not meant to be.
This also moves the collectCategoriesAndSpokes, collect_categories, and
collect_spokes functions into pyanaconda.ui.common since I could at
least consolidate that.

[anaconda][initial-setup][rhel7-branch][PATCH] Fix translations in Initial Setup
by Martin Kolman
As can be seen in the de_DE or pt_BR locale, Initial Setup current does not translate
many strings in the GUI even though they are properly translated in the PO files.
Turns out all strings specified in Glade and the spoke title are affected.
It is caused by Initial Setup using Hub and Spoke classes from Anaconda,
which all have the "anaconda" translation domain hardcoded.
Like this translations are looked up in the "anaconda" instead of the
"initial-setup" domain and the strings remain untranslated.
Fortunately, the fix turned out to be pretty simple. :)
The patch for Anaconda adds support for overriding the Hub translation domain
by subclasses and also forwards the spoke domain to gettext when translating spoke title.
The patch for Initial Setup makes sure all Hub and Spoke subclasses
override the translation domain with the "initial-setup" one.
This together makes sure all strings are properly translated.

[blivet] refactor lvm info gathering
by David Lehman
This slightly improves how we gather information from lvm about
existing devices. It then adds caching to consolidate calls to lvm
utilities on systems with many PVs and/or VGs.
This version does not enable caching for anaconda, but I think I
should remove that piece. Does anyone object? What it means is that
we'll only run pvs and lvs once per call to DeviceTree.populate,
regardless of the number of PVs or VGs present. I think we call
populate after any operation that could add a new PV in anaconda, so
it should be safe.
Jan, if you're reading this, I'd also be open to adding a way to tell
the devicetree not to drop the cache on populate. Let me know if that
sounds useful.
